Description
The HIP2 monoclonal antibody reacts with the human CD41 molecule, a subunit of the integrin α
IIb also known as platelet GPIIb. CD41 non-covalently associates with integrin β
3 (GPIIIa, CD61) and is expressed by megakaryocytes and platelets. The CD41/CD61 complex is a receptor for fibronectin, fibrinogen, von Willebrand factor, vitronectin and thrombospondin and mediates platelets aggregation. HIP2 blocks platelet aggregation.

Applications Tested
The HIP2 antibody has been pre-titrated and tested by flow cytometric analysis of human peripheral blood leukocytes. This can be used at 20 μl (2 μg) per 100 μl blood (or per 1 million cells in 100 μl total staining volume).
